  8. Mr Trailer Man

    Harness help please :)

    This is where 5/6 point harnesses come in to their own with the anti sub crotch strap(s). You need to get the waist straps on 4 points nice and tight before you do the shoulder straps. The adjuster buckle usually sits about half way between the seat side hole and the point where the strap is...

  22. Mr Trailer Man

    Cleaning and paint help!

    Don't wash them in anything that has fabric softener in either, it'll bugger them up. Either get some dedicated microfibre wash or use bog standard non-bio stuff (liquid, not powder).

  27. Mr Trailer Man

    Cleaning and paint help!

    Megs Scratch 2.0 is more of a cutting compound, so you're more than likely to be inducing swirls just by the nature of it. Think of it like T-Cut. You'll need a finer finishing polish to safely remove swirls.
